Description Paul Worrall 2024-05-30 13:10:51 UTC
kcmshell6 kcm_powerdevilprofilesconfig

The KCM is displayed but allows no input. It cannot even be closed.

Similar freeze if selecting "Power Management" from within System Settings but without even displaying the KCM
Comment 1 Jakob Petsovits 2024-06-03 01:57:35 UTC
Are you running a dev build that isn't installed system-wide? There's an unfortunately unavoidable issue with the Power Management KCM now requiring a matching 6.1 version of the "org.kde.powerdevil.chargethresholdhelper" KAuth helper, and whoever hasn't replaced their system's pre-existing chargethreshold helper will experience a hanging KCM.

See https://community.kde.org/Plasma/Plasma_6#Known_issues for a few extra links regarding the KAuth issue (unfortunately the systemd-sysext overlay MR that would make switching easier hasn't been merged so far).
